Error compiling Mysql-server-5.5.2

I ran into the problem again. i tried to make version 5.5.4 and error
__sync_fetch_and_add_8

sys/libmysys.a ../../dbug/libdbug.a ../../strings/libmystrings.a -lpthread -lm -lpthread
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.o: in function `test_atomic_add64':
my_atomic-t.c:(.text+0x368): undefined reference to `__sync_fetch_and_add_8'
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.c:(.text+0x38c): undefined reference to `__sync_fetch_and_add_8'
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.c:(.text+0x3a0): undefined reference to `__sync_fetch_and_add_8'
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.c:(.text+0x3ac): undefined reference to `__sync_fetch_and_add_8'
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.o: in function `do_tests':
my_atomic-t.c:(.text+0x7e0): undefined reference to `__sync_fetch_and_add_8'
/home/admin/jj/staging_dir/toolchain-mipsel_24kc_gcc-7.5.0_musl/bin/../lib/gcc/mipsel-openwrt-linux-musl/7.5.0/../../../../mipsel-openwrt-linux-musl/bin/ld: my_atomic-t.o:my_atomic-t.c:(.text+0x7f4): more undefined references to `__sync_fetch_and_add_8' follow
collect2: error: ld returned 1 exit status
Makefile:627: recipe for target 'my_atomic-t' failed
make[5]: *** [my_atomic-t] Error 1
make[5]: Leaving directory '/home/admin/jj/build_dir/target-mipsel_24kc_musl/mysql-5.5.4-m3/unittest/mysys'
Makefile:570: recipe for target 'all-recursive' failed